Word jij onze nieuwe Data Engineer?Creating Healthy spaces has been Renson’s baseline for more than a decade. To truly achieve this promise, we are continuously updating our products to become connected smart devices. Renson has developed an IoT eco-system (My-Lio) to support these connected devices. The telemetry and usage data of these connected devices is collected to further improve our product leadership position. We are looking for an additional data engineer to strengthen our R&D team for Data Analytics within the R&D department for Digital Innovation.
More Specifically, Your Job Will Involve The Following Tasks
As Data Engineer, you will develop and maintain Renson’s production grade data platform to allow the processing of data gathered from Renson’s connected devices. You will be expected to further develop the platform while also assisting the data analysts and scientists by preparing the data for further study. You will work closely together with other members of Renson’s R&D department for Digital Innovation such as our IoT cloud engineers and architect. Your input during the development process will be highly valued to improve the platform.
- Write, debug, test and review software for Renson’s IoT data platform while respecting Renson’s version control standards.
- Monitor and maintain different tools within Renson’s data infrastructure (e.g., airflow, Databricks, …)
- Estimate the workload of development tasks.
- Write detailed documentation of the designed software solution.
- Release software from development environments to staging and production environments.
- Report to the project stakeholders regarding the project progress and concerns.
- Assist data analysts and scientists in getting data sets for their research.
- You are experienced in software development (preferably in Python)
- You are familiar with cloud computing (preferably Microsoft Azure)
- You have a passion for telemetry data from buildings
- You have strong skills in critical thinking and are interested in details
- You are a team player: collaboration, oral and written communication
- You are focused on quality with a bias for action
- Affinity and interest in applied mathematics (more particularly data analytics and control theory) is a plus
